Solving Security Issues, One Step at a Time
One of the most fulfilling aspects of the role was tackling the multitude of small yet significant security issues that arose. Each issue demanded a meticulous approach—whether it was fine-tuning firewalls, conducting regular vulnerability assessments, or enhancing the system’s monitoring capabilities. The goal was always clear: to fortify the OT environment against potential threats while ensuring its seamless operation.
